Very nice restaurant with welcoming atmosphere situated next to the lake of zurich. Summertime has a lovely open terrace. Other times indoor seating in a older/“retro-ish” night club/cabaret styled facility. Some of the chairs fee a little worn (mine had a hole in the upholstery) but that did not stop the feel-good factor for me. Went there for Sunday Brunch. In switzerland “brunch” tends to refer to the times that the kitchen is open, rather than “all you can eat” or “buffet” type eating. Food is ordered a la carte. The eggs benedict with salmon are excellent and the waffle with chicken an interesting and positively surprising combo. On Sunday I reserved for 1300. Reservations are always recommended in switzerland at peak dining times, though in my partial case they would have been able to accommodate us without a reservation as well. The staff was friendly. For the crispy fried chicken on the waffle there was one small piece that was still raw inside. We alerted the staff and were immediately an apology and an offer to have a new dish/serving prepared. We asked for only an additional/new small piece of chicken but received a completely new full serving anyway. The uncomplicated way of providing a solution and trying to compensate/correct the issue was highly appreciated: well done! The kids were satisfied with waffles & ice cream. Parking on Sundays is bo issue with an open public paid parking 50m away from the restaurant. During summertime finding parking close by is more challenging. I was informed by the waitress that they have evening dining with set course menus and cabaret type entertainment during evenings (enquire for details).

Samigo is definitely a place to check out to have a great view of the lake and a nice time with friends (including the club and rooftop). It’s a well known place among locals. When I was there for brunch last year, the whole place was pink, now it is yellow. Anyways, I like the marketing they are doing. Our brunch was great, also prices in line with the ZH scene and bonus for the view - the only thing I wasn’t too convinced of (not sure if still there) was the coconut yoghurt on the pancakes. Rather tasteless (but this is a problem with soy and coconut products quite some times). Still, very good brunch, and we loved the Serrano ham on our bruschetta. On the dinner side: I tried their famous pizza, which they claim to be the best in Zurich (or, a very good one), based on the dough. Now, I am Italian and I come from the north - the napolitanean is not my favorite version. I like my pizza to be crispy and thin (and Zurich isn’t really a great haven for these pizzas). I have had better pizzas in Zurich, and, although the filling was good (as good as a regular pizza can be), I really didn’t enjoy the crust - way too think and bready for my taste. This pizza style is not for everyone, but it is not a bad one. If you like the Neapolitan then you will enjoy it. My friend was also rather disappointed with the prawn salad (there was only one salad leaf). The taste was good, but the portion was rather an appetizer (but this is common in many other places in ZH). Service was also good and efficient despite the place being full. So: I would definitely go back for drinks and brunch.
